đź’Ľ

Software Engineer at Cisco

NEW
Location
Bengaluru, Karnataka, India
Job type
Full time
Posted 1 day ago
Description
500+
Master Backend Engineering
AI-First Software Engineering
Next batch starts on 13 Mar
Always stay in the know!
Join our community and stay notified of latest job opportunities.
Tap to Apply

Frequently Asked Questions

What responsibilities does a Software Engineer at Cisco in Bengaluru have?
Chevron down
What qualifications are needed for the Senior Software Engineer position at Cisco in Bengaluru?
Chevron down
What is the work environment like for a Software Engineer at Cisco in Bengaluru?
Chevron down
What is the application process for the Software Engineer at Cisco in Bengaluru?
Chevron down
What makes Cisco a desirable company to work for as a Software Engineer?
Chevron down
Is there any travel required for the Software Engineer role at Cisco in Bengaluru?
Chevron down

Why Work at Cisco

Cisco Systems is a global leader in networking hardware and software solutions, making it an enticing workplace for tech enthusiasts and seasoned professionals alike. The company's commitment to innovation, diversity, and community support makes it a sought-after employer in the tech industry. Working at Cisco offers numerous benefits, from professional growth opportunities to a supportive work environment.

Cisco’s focus on technology and innovation provides employees the chance to work on cutting-edge projects that shape the future of connectivity and communication. This emphasis on innovation permeates the culture, ensuring that employees are continually challenged and inspired to think creatively.

Furthermore, Cisco places a strong emphasis on work-life balance, which is reflected in its flexible work schedules and comprehensive benefits packages. Employees at Cisco enjoy competitive salaries, health insurance, retirement plans, and numerous wellness programs—all designed to support physical and mental well-being.

Cisco also values diversity and inclusivity, fostering a workplace where employees from different backgrounds can thrive. This diverse environment encourages unique perspectives and ideas, enhancing team collaboration and driving innovation.

What’s it Like to Work at Cisco

Working at Cisco, particularly in its Bengaluru, Karnataka office, means being part of a vibrant and dynamic team. The company prides itself on its open and collaborative culture. Employees are encouraged to share ideas and participate in decision-making processes, regardless of their position in the company.

Cisco is renowned for its learning and development programs. Employees have access to various training resources and courses to enhance their skills and advance their careers. The company supports continued education through professional certifications and encourages its engineers to stay updated with the latest industry trends and technologies.

In addition to professional growth, Cisco employees benefit from numerous social and team-building events that foster a sense of community. These events are great opportunities for networking and collaboration, helping employees build strong relationships with colleagues from different departments.

What’s it Like to Work as a Software Engineer at Cisco

As a Software Engineer at Cisco, you will be at the forefront of developing innovative solutions that impact the global technology landscape. The role is challenging and rewarding, offering the chance to work on diverse projects that utilize the latest technologies and methodologies.

Software Engineers at Cisco are encouraged to be creative and proactive in problem-solving, driving the development of efficient and scalable solutions. The company supports its engineers with state-of-the-art tools and platforms, enabling them to perform at their best.

The work environment for Software Engineers at Cisco is collaborative and supportive. Teamwork is highly encouraged, and engineers regularly engage in peer reviews, brainstorming sessions, and collaborative coding projects. This approach not only enhances the quality of the work but also fosters personal and professional growth.

Cisco’s focus on innovation means that software engineers are constantly exploring new areas and expanding their skill sets. The company provides ample opportunities for engineers to engage in cross-functional projects and work with international teams, broadening their experience and perspective.

Software Engineer Interview Questions at Cisco

Preparing for an interview for a Software Engineer position at Cisco involves familiarizing yourself with both technical and behavioral questions. Cisco looks for candidates who not only possess technical expertise but also align with its company culture and values.

Technical questions often cover areas such as algorithms, data structures, system design, and problem-solving skills. Candidates may be asked to demonstrate their coding abilities through technical tests and live coding exercises. It’s important to be proficient in the programming languages and technologies relevant to the role.

Behavioral questions at Cisco focus on understanding the candidate's ability to work in a team, handle conflict, and manage projects. Interviewers may ask about past experiences where candidates demonstrated leadership, creativity, or resilience.

Some common interview questions include:

  • Explain a time when you faced a significant technical challenge. How did you overcome it?
  • Describe a project you worked on that didn't go as planned. What was your role, and how did you manage the situation?
  • How do you stay updated with the latest technology trends?

Software Engineer Interview Preparation at Cisco

Preparing for a Software Engineer interview at Cisco involves a combination of technical preparation and understanding of the company’s values and culture. Start by reviewing the job description and required skills to ensure you have a clear understanding of what Cisco expects from candidates.

Brush up on your technical knowledge, focusing on algorithms, data structures, coding practices, and system design. Practice coding problems using platforms like LeetCode, HackerRank, or CodeSignal. Engage in mock interviews to hone your problem-solving and communication skills under pressure.

Researching Cisco’s history, its products, and its corporate culture is equally important. Understanding Cisco’s mission and values will help you align your responses with what the company stands for. Articulate how your experiences and goals align with Cisco’s objectives.

Study the STAR (Situation, Task, Action, Result) method for answering behavioral questions. This will help you provide structured and impactful responses that highlight your abilities and past experiences effectively.

Software Engineer Interview Tips at Cisco

To excel in an interview with Cisco, consider the following tips:

  1. Showcase Problem-Solving Skills: Cisco values engineers who can tackle complex problems efficiently. Demonstrate not only your technical expertise but also your analytical and problem-solving approach.

  2. Highlight Collaboration and Communication: Emphasize your ability to work well in a team. Provide examples of how you have successfully collaborated with others on projects.

  3. Be Authentic: Cisco looks for candidates who are genuine and passionate about their work. Express your enthusiasm for technology and innovation, and be honest about your experiences and knowledge.

  4. Prepare Thoughtful Questions: At the end of the interview, asking insightful questions about the role, team dynamics, or upcoming projects can demonstrate your serious interest in the position and company.

  5. Follow-Up Professionally: After your interview, consider writing a thank-you email to express gratitude for the opportunity, reiterate your interest in the position, and summarize how your skills align with the company’s needs.

By thoroughly preparing and understanding Cisco’s work environment, you can present yourself as a well-rounded candidate poised to make significant contributions to the company.